Thu, 16 May 2013 21:54:46 -0700 Chicago Cubs SP Matt Garza (lat) logged six shutout innings Thursday, May 16, in a rehab start for Triple-A Iowa. He allowed two hits and struck out six while not allowing a walk. He's on schedule to join the big-league club sometime next week. When Garza comes back, P Carlos Villanueva looks like the most realistic rotation casualty. Though manager Dale Sveum hasn't shut down the idea of a six-man rotation, it's unlikely to happen in the long term. Fantasy Tip: He'll probably have around two months to work back into form so the Cubs can showcase him for a possible late-July trade. Villanueva can be dropped in mixed leagues when Garza re-establishes his rotation spot. Scott Feldman has pitched relatively well lately, and Villanueva's past bullpen experience is actually working against his fantasy value here.
Tue, 14 May 2013 14:19:32 -0700 Chicago Cubs manager Dale Sveum said the team may use a six-man rotation when SP Matt Garza (lat) returns to the team. Fantasy Tip: Travis Wood, Scott Feldman and Carlos Villanueva have all been carrying their weight in the rotation, so Sveum might find it too hard to bump one of them to the bullpen to make room for Garza. Don't expect the six-man rotation to last for long, though, so those three might be competing to stay in the rotation in their next few starts.
Wed, 08 May 2013 12:56:40 -0700 Chicago Cubs SP Scott Feldman (finger) is fine after leaving in the eighth inning of his start Monday, May 6, with cramping in his right index finger. Fantasy Tip: Feldman has surprised with his performances since moving to the National League. Pitching at Wrigley Field is never easy, and with a pitcher like Feldman, you have to be skeptical. But he's getting it done and has the confidence to be considered for a roster spot in deep mixed leagues.
Sat, 13 Apr 2013 09:48:43 -0700 Chicago Cubs SP Scott Feldman (back) will not pitch until Saturday, April 20, against the Milwaukee Brewers, because he is currently bothered by tightness in his back.
Thu, 14 Feb 2013 11:19:59 -0800 Chicago Cubs manager Dale Sveum said SP Scott Feldman will be in the starting rotation this year and SP Scott Baker (elbow) will likely be held back at the start of the season.
Wed, 13 Feb 2013 21:54:58 -0800 Chicago Cubs SPs Scott Baker, Scott Feldman, Carlos Villanueva and Travis Wood are all in competition for the final two rotation spots. "Gotta fight for the job," Wood said Tuesday, Feb. 12. "May the best man win." Feldman likely has the inside track for a spot, as he is a former 17-game winner for the Texas Rangers back in 2009.
Fri, 08 Feb 2013 20:46:56 -0800 Chicago Cubs SP Scott Feldman is projected to serve as the fifth starter. One of the reasons he wanted to sign with the Cubs was to be a full-time starter.
Fri, 30 Nov 2012 06:05:36 -0800 The Kansas City Royals offered SP Scott Feldman a one-year, $4.5 million deal before he signed with the Chicago Cubs.
Tue, 27 Nov 2012 13:22:50 -0800 Chicago Cubs general manager Jed Hoyer said SP Scott Feldman will serve as a starter with the team. The team also expects SP Scott Baker (elbow) to fill out the starting rotation next season.
Tue, 27 Nov 2012 07:36:53 -0800 Updating an immediate report, the Chicago Cubs have agreed with free-agent SP Scott Feldman (Rangers) on a one-year, $6 million deal that includes $1 million in incentives.
